The AI tool market is crowded, and most products promise to “revolutionize your workflow” or “10x your productivity.” But which ones actually deliver?

After testing dozens of tools in real-world scenarios, here are five that consistently save time without requiring a PhD in prompt engineering or hours of setup. These aren’t the flashiest—they’re the ones that work.

1. Otter.ai for Meeting Transcription

Otter.ai records, transcribes, and summarizes meetings in real time. The free tier gives you 300 monthly minutes, which is enough for most users.

What makes it worth using: It integrates directly with Zoom and Google Meet, automatically joins scheduled meetings, and generates a searchable transcript with speaker labels. The summary feature pulls out action items and key decisions without you lifting a finger.

Time saved: 15–30 minutes per meeting you don’t have to manually review or take notes during.

2. Grammarly for Instant Writing Cleanup

Yes, Grammarly has been around for years, but the AI-powered version (Grammarly GO) now rewrites sentences, adjusts tone, and catches context issues that basic spell-check misses.

What makes it worth using: It works everywhere—email, Google Docs, Slack, LinkedIn. The browser extension means you’re never copy-pasting into a separate tool. The tone detector is surprisingly accurate and helps you avoid sounding too casual in professional emails or too stiff in friendly ones.

Time saved: 5–10 minutes per email or document, plus the mental energy of second-guessing your phrasing.

3. Perplexity for Fast, Cited Research

Perplexity is a search engine powered by AI that gives you direct answers with linked sources. Think of it as Google meets ChatGPT, but with citations you can actually verify.

What makes it worth using: Instead of clicking through ten articles to answer a simple question (“What’s the best CRM for a team of five?” or “What are the current import taxes on electronics?”), Perplexity synthesizes the answer and shows you where it came from. The Pro version searches academic databases and recent news, making it useful for work research, not just trivia.

Time saved: 10–20 minutes per research session by skipping the tab explosion.

4. Notion AI for Document Cleanup and Summaries

If you already use Notion, the built-in AI is a no-brainer. If you don’t, it’s still worth considering for teams that need shared docs, meeting notes, and project wikis.

What makes it worth using: Highlight any block of text and ask Notion AI to summarize, expand, translate, or rewrite it. It’s particularly good at turning messy brainstorm notes into clean, structured outlines. The “Ask AI” feature lets you query your entire workspace (“What were the action items from last week’s sprint planning?”).

Time saved: 10–15 minutes per document you need to organize or review.

5. Zapier Central for Simple Automation

Zapier Central is the AI layer on top of Zapier’s automation platform. You describe what you want in plain English (“Every time I get an email with ‘invoice’ in the subject, save the attachment to Google Drive and add a row to my expenses spreadsheet”), and it builds the workflow for you.

What makes it worth using: No coding, no flowchart-building. You talk to it like a person. It handles multi-step workflows across apps (Slack, Gmail, Trello, Airtable, etc.) that would otherwise require manual copy-pasting or expensive custom integrations.

Time saved: Hours per week if you’re doing repetitive tasks across multiple apps.

Why These Five?

They share three traits: they integrate into tools you already use, they require minimal setup, and they solve annoying, repetitive problems that eat up your day. You’ll notice results within the first week, not after months of “optimization.”

None of these tools will replace your job or think for you. But they will give you back hours every week to do the work that actually requires a human.
